Former 5-Star TE Chris Clark Schedules Official

Former 5-star Tight End Chris Clark wanted to transfer back closer to home (Avon, Connecticut), and UCLA has granted him his release.  According to Scout’s Brian Dohn, Clark will be taking an official visit to NC State on October 31st when the Wolpack battle the Clemson Tigers.  Clark was the #1 Tight End in the 2015 recruiting class.  Back in 2014, Clark committed to both UNC and Michigan before ultimately committing to UCLA.  UCLA has blocked Clark’s ability to transfer to Michigan.

“It did not take long for schools to flock to former 5-star Tight End Chris Clark after receiving his release from UCLA.  As he searches for a Transfer, he told Scout that he will visit Pittsburgh officially October 10th, October 17th he will officially visit Virginia, and on October 31st he will officially visit North Carolina State.  Clark left UCLA wanting to get closer to home, and those schools definitely fit that bill.  He could set a couple of other official visits.  This means he will not be enrolled in a school in the Fall, but will look to enroll in one in January.  He already played a game with UCLA this season, but it will be up to the NCAA to decide whether he has to sit out the 2016 season, or whether he can just sit out the first couple of weeks of it, and then pick it up from there.”  (Scout)
